Common Contaminants Hiding in Your Air Ducts

While many homeowners may not realize it, a variety of harmful particles can accumulate in air ducts, creating hazards for both personal health and indoor air quality. Dust, dirt, and debris accumulate over time, often forming large deposits. These particles can be inhaled, triggering respiratory conditions overview such as asthma, allergies, and other breathing difficulties. In addition, mold spores may form in humid areas, leading to significant health risks if released into the air.

Insects and rodents, such as mice and bugs, can make their way into HVAC ducts, leaving behind feces and residue that contribute to poor air quality. Furthermore, volatile organic compounds from common domestic items can accumulate in the ductwork, releasing harmful gases. Routine duct maintenance helps eliminate these harmful substances, supporting a cleaner living space and enhancing the quality of indoor air. Recognizing these unseen pollutants is critical to maintaining a safe and comfortable living space.

Research Credentials and Experience

A thorough evaluation of certifications and background is crucial when selecting an air duct cleaning service. Property owners should commence by checking the company's certifications, such as those from the National Air Duct Cleaners Association (NADCA). These qualifications indicate compliance with industry guidelines and best practices. Background also plays a critical role; a company with a long history in the field is likely to have encountered various issues and developed effective approaches. Additionally, examining customer ratings and comments can offer valuable information about the level of professionalism. Ensuring that the contractor is properly covered and protected further safeguards residents from potential financial burdens. By prioritizing these elements, individuals can select confidently when choosing an air duct cleaning provider.

Should You Clean Your Air Ducts Yourself or Hire a Pro?

When considering whether to clean air ducts oneself or to enlist professional help, homeowners often weigh the pros and cons of each option. Self-cleaning may appear to be a budget-friendly solution, enabling homeowners to avoid professional service costs. Nevertheless, the process demands time, dedication, and a degree of skill to thoroughly eliminate dust, allergens, and debris. Using incorrect methods may result in inadequate cleaning, which could further compromise indoor air quality.

Conversely, enlisting professional services provides numerous benefits. Skilled technicians have access to specialized equipment and expertise, delivering a complete cleaning that satisfies industry requirements. Additionally, they can uncover hidden issues, including mold or deterioration, that a homeowner might miss. Despite the higher initial cost of professional services, the enduring benefits of superior air quality and system efficiency commonly make the expense worthwhile. In the end, the choice should take into account elements such as budget, available time, and goals for indoor air quality.

How Often Should My Air Ducts Be Cleaned?

Air ducts ought to be cleaned once every three to five years, based on factors such as home occupancy, pet ownership, and allergy sensitivities. Regular maintenance enhances the quality of air and overall efficiency, providing a healthier home environment for residents.

Can Cleaning Your Air Ducts Help Reduce Energy Costs?

Air duct cleaning can indeed reduce energy bills. By eliminating dust and debris buildup, it helps HVAC systems run at peak efficiency, ultimately lowering energy consumption and resulting in potential savings on monthly utility expenses for homeowners.

What Equipment Is Used for Air Duct Cleaning?

Air duct cleaning commonly requires professional-grade tools such as powerful vacuums, air whips, and rotary brushes. Such equipment efficiently eliminates debris, dust, and harmful contaminants, guaranteeing a comprehensive cleaning procedure that enhances both air quality and system performance.

Is Air Duct Cleaning a Safe Process for Your Pets?

Air duct cleaning is generally safe for pets when carried out by trained professionals using proper techniques and equipment. Ensuring the use of non-toxic materials and preserving a tidy living space supports a safer and healthier indoor space for your pets.

Do Any DIY Air Duct Cleaning Tips Exist?

Helpful DIY air duct cleaning suggestions involve using a vacuum with a long hose, brushing accessible ducts, sealing leaks with foil tape, and consistently replacing filters. These steps can help maintain better air quality without professional help.
